2.3 Ga Magmatism and 1.94 Ga Metamorphism in the Xiatang Area, Southern Margin of the North China Craton — Evidence from Whole-rock Geochemistry and Zircon Geochronology and Hf Isotope

This paper reports whole-rock geochemistry and zircon geochronology and Hf isotope of gneissic granite and biotite-amphibole-plagioclase gneiss from the Xiatang area, southern margin of the North China Craton. They occur in Mesoproterozoic granite as enclaves. The gneissic granite shows anatectic features. Combined with early researches, the conclusions can be arrived at that 1 ) there is a huge about 2.3 Ga rock distribution area in western Henan Province, southern margin of the North China Craton, and 2) the Trans-North China Orogen shared similar Late Paleoproteorzoic tectono-thermal evolution to the Khondalite belt in the northwestern North China Craton.
